Everything about ???? LLM Engineer's Handbook
Everything about ???? LLM Engineer's Handbook
Blog Article
We depend upon LLMs to function given that the brains inside the agent system, strategizing and breaking down elaborate responsibilities into workable sub-steps, reasoning and actioning at Every sub-stage iteratively till we get there at an answer. Outside of just the processing electrical power of those ‘brains’, the integration of exterior methods such as memory and applications is essential.
The dearth of interpretability and trustworthiness can lead to uncertainty and hesitation among developers, who may be hesitant to count on LLM-produced code with out a very clear comprehension of how it had been derived.
Portion 8 discusses the problems nonetheless for being prevail over when utilizing LLMs to solve SE jobs and highlights promising opportunities and directions for upcoming study.
The scholar council coordinator manages and approves activities for which Every club places forward proposals. The club coordinators for each club can increase or edit the club’s details and agenda functions and club actions, which will then be accredited initial by the scholar council coordinator then the administrator.
In analyzing the parameters of our product, we look at a number of trade-offs among design dimension, context window, inference time, memory footprint, plus more. Larger products ordinarily give much better efficiency and are more capable of transfer learning. But these types have larger computational requirements for the two training and inference.
These LLMs excel in knowledge and processing textual knowledge, producing them an ideal choice for tasks that contain code comprehension, bug repairing, code generation, and other textual content-oriented SE issues. Their capability to approach and find out from vast quantities of text details enables them to offer effective insights and options for a variety of SE applications. Textual content-based mostly datasets with a large number of prompts (28) are generally Utilized in training LLMs for SE duties to guide their actions properly.
An agent replicating this issue-solving tactic is considered adequately autonomous. Paired with an evaluator, it permits iterative refinements of a particular stage, retracing to a prior phase, and formulating a new route until an answer emerges.
The utilization of LLMs In this particular context don't just improves efficiency in running bug reviews but in addition contributes to strengthening the general software enhancement and servicing workflow, lowering redundancy, and making sure prompt bug resolution (Zhang et al., 2023b).
For entrepreneurs in the past MacBook Pro How can the MacBook take care of running community LLM versions in comparison to a desktop that has a 3090?
Through inference, an API look for tool is integrated in to the era course of action, allowing for the model to immediately benefit from the Instrument for tips when picking out APIs.
The aforementioned chain of ideas is usually directed with or with no supplied illustrations and may deliver an answer in a single output era. When integrating shut-kind LLMs with exterior equipment or data retrieval, the execution benefits and observations from these tools are included in to the enter prompt for each LLM Enter-Output (I-O) cycle, alongside the former reasoning measures. A program will url these sequences seamlessly.
This results in being notably important in situations exactly where regular datasets, like those derived from software repositories or common benchmarks, are both minimal or absence the granularity essential for distinct responsibilities.
In this particular input form, LLMs discover from the Visible styles and constructions inside the code to execute duties like code translation or generating code visualizations.
Evaluator Ranker (LLM-assisted; Optional): If several candidate options emerge within the planner for a certain stage, an evaluator should really rank them to highlight the most ideal. This module becomes redundant if just one strategy is created at a time.ml engineer